Output 5a83ce31fa95a2fb71c7174e252d39bccb6837311e202d85e1d6dbd3ec9a8fc6:0

value
3856055856
script pubkey
OP_HASH160 OP_PUSHBYTES_20 55dd14bbcf6f417c38645d36bfc2806a57f4a530 OP_EQUAL
address
39X2CprVTHXP98MGaTorFw33JBKhRsSn5N
transaction
5a83ce31fa95a2fb71c7174e252d39bccb6837311e202d85e1d6dbd3ec9a8fc6
confirmations
193942
spent
true